Interpreting TDS Form 16: Your Tax Withholding Statement
Form 16 is a crucial document for Indian taxpayers as it serves as a confirmation of tax deducted at source (TDS) from your income during the financial year. This form, sent by your employer or withholding agent, provides a thorough breakdown of the TDS deducted throughout the year.
By analyzing Form 16, you can confirm that the correct amount of TDS has been deducted and facilitate your tax filing process. It includes essential details such as your PAN, salary details, and the breakdown of TDS deducted on different income heads.
- Furthermore, Form 16 can be helpful in claiming refunds if you have overpaid taxes during the year.
- Remember it's important to keep your Form 16 secure as it serves as a valuable record of your tax compliance.

TDS Compliance for Businesses: Avoiding Penalties and Hassles
For businesses operating in numerous sectors, understanding and complying with TDS regulations is crucial. Non-compliance can lead to substantial penalties and extra hassles. To minimize these risks, businesses must establish a robust TDS compliance framework. This involves identifying applicable TDS provisions, calculating the correct amount of tax to be deducted, and transmitting returns on time. By carefully managing TDS obligations, businesses can confirm smooth operations and avoid potential legal complications.
